Human Resources Assistant - Temporary Position
POSITION SUMMARY:
The Human Resources Assistant is a critical member of the Human Resources department at The Adirondack Trust Company. This role assists in all areas of the department, including recruitment assistance, payroll, file maintenance and other daily administrative tasks. Applicants must be willing to perform all necessary job functions and uphold employee and retiree confidentiality. This position is a temporary assignment.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Must maintain a high level of confidentiality in compliance with HIPAA and The Adirondack Trust Company culture and policies.
Processes transactions for internal employee movie ticket orders.
Payroll processing responsibilities will include scanning payroll documents, file maintenance, and monitoring timecards.
Creates forms, documents, and correspondence on behalf of HR, which include creating and sending confirmation letters, first day agendas, mail merge projects, and required notifications.
Provides support for the recruiting process by assisting with candidate pre-screenings, scheduling interviews, maintaining applicant records, and the staffing and applicant activity logs.
Assists in the onboarding of new employees by preparing and presenting new hire orientation, reviewing onboarding documents, and preparing brand bags.
Acts as a resource for basic employee questions.
Maintains and tracks Performance Management. Assigns and ensures reviews are being completed by managers in a timely manner and escalates training plans to the Senior HR Generalist.
*Other duties as assigned
MINIMUM JOB REQUIREMENTS:
This position requires experience in a business setting, excellent written and verbal communication skills, and strong analytical skills. The ideal candidate must be results-driven, possess a sense of urgency, be very organized, and be able to maintain a high level of professionalism. Prior experience in the Human Resources field or an associate degree are preferred but not required.
PHYSICAL DEMANDS:
Must be able to hear well enough to communicate with customers and co-workers, and communicate orally.
Normal daily physical activities include walking, standing, sitting, stooping, bending, pushing, and pulling.
Must be able to read reports and use a computer.
Occasionally will lift 20-30 pounds (files, cash drawer, etc.)
